测试站点 + 实时站点上的分析
Analytics on test site + live site
我们正在测试和实时部署.war
servlet。
我懒得把条件代码放在包含分析与否,我可以在两个站点上使用相同的代码吗,分析是否只显示实时站点的统计信息?(因为这是注册域名)
它会排除测试命中吗?
我建议你留在你的分析测试站点:你必须测试跟踪是否有效。
传统方法是创建一个分析配置文件,该配置文件仅考虑测试版本和排除此版本的其他版本。借助分析界面中的过滤器(基于您的主机或 IP),您可以做到这一点。
您可以使用location.host来确定该站点是否正在开发中。
if(location.host=='mysite.com') {
_gaq.push(['_trackPageview']);
}
或者可能是该代码的反面:
if(location.host!='localhost') {
_gaq.push(['_trackPageview']);
}
是的,只需比较主机名。喜欢这个:
<script>if ('example.com' === window.location.hostname){
// Google Analytics - mathiasbynens.be/notes/async-analytics-snippet - Change UA-XXXXX-X to your ID:
var _gaq=[["_setAccount","UA-XXXXX-X"],["_trackPageview"]];
(function(d,t){var g=d.createElement(t),s=d.getElementsByTagName(t)[0];g.async=1;g.src=("https:"==location.protocol?"//ssl":"//www")+".google-analytics.com/ga.js";s.parentNode.insertBefore(g,s)}(document,"script"));
}</script>
如果您使用的是www.
那么也要检查一下。
相关文章:
- 使用Facebook live API创建实时视频对象时的隐私设置
- 有任何可能将facebook实时信使整合到一个网站中
- 标记的实时更新,无需加载页面谷歌地图API V3
- 使用javascript进行实时图像处理
- JavaScript滚动脚本-在测试中激发,而不是在开发站点上
- 通过iframe登录到远程站点
- 如何在jquery中使用实时计算求和值
- JavaScript:将所见即所得编辑器对实时站点的更改转换为jQuery操作
- 引导工具提示在实时站点上不起作用,但在控制台上运行良好
- 幻灯片在本地工作,但在实时站点上不工作
- 为什么我的程序在我的测试环境中工作,而不是我的实时站点
- 为什么我的 javascript 在测试环境中工作,但在实时站点上不起作用
- 测试站点 + 实时站点上的分析
- 在jsFiddle中工作,但不在实时站点上工作
- “严格使用”对实时站点安全吗?
- Javascript 谷歌地理位置在实时站点中不起作用
- 有没有办法实时存储/更新Facebook api '分享','喜欢'对站点上的每个页面到
- 在一个实时站点上编辑js脚本
- Javascript 函数在测试站点和实时站点上返回不同的结果
- 使用ajax实时更新站点?JQuery